See More... (Bavaria) AUSSTELLUNG VON ARBEITEN DER VERVIELFÄLTIGENDEN KÜNSTE IM BAYRISCHEN GEWERBEMUSEUM
Nürnberg n.p. 1877 8vo. quarter cloth with paper-covered boards with stiff paper wrapper bound in vii, 214+(1) plus 11 leaves of illustration
Catalogues objects relating to a variety of topics connected to the book arts in Bavarian collections. Chapters on prominent publishers, seventeenth century book decoration, woodcuts, metalcutting, lithography, photography and different types of presses and printing technology. All chapters divided in two sections: a general overview followed by a bibliography usually arranged chronologically, sometimes arranged by topography. Engraved illustrations throughout. Ten illustrations grouped at the back. One page in color. Engraved frontispiece with tissue guard. Most of the text printed in gothic typeface. Title page printed in red and black. Decorative initial letters printed in red. A variety of head and tail pieces. Loose bookplate indicates that this copy was purchased from the collection of H.P. Kraus. See More... (Beaumont Press) Blunden, Edmund. TO NATURE
Westminster Beaumont Press (1923) 8vo. quarter cloth with patterned paper-covered boards, fore and bottom edges deckled (xii), 50, (2) pages
Limited to 390 numbered copies (Beaumont, pp.70-72). The cover decorations, endpapers. and 34 Initial Letters designed by Randolph Schwabe, The typography and binding arranged by Cyril William Beaumont on his Press at 75 Charing Cross Road, Westminster. An advance copy of the book was acknowledged by Edmund Blunden: "It is a book which almost topples over my stern faith in the art of earlier printers as compared with the modern, and will stand in honor on my shelves...Mr. Schwabe's little pictures have my warm praise and gratitude."
